For overseas spousal visa applications the destination requires the full chain — Kor Ror 2 + Kor Ror 3 + Certificate authentication — which we deliver as one package.

Field experience — Bangkok Marriage Registration at Amphur (Bang Rak)

Previously divorced parties need a divorce decree or certificate, Document attestationd / legalized in the country of origin and translated + MFA-legalized in Thailand.

Technical analysis — Bangkok Marriage Registration at Amphur (Bang Rak)

If the Thai spouse changes surname, we update the national ID, household registration, passport, and any other affected documents in a single engagement.

Working notes — Bangkok Marriage Registration at Amphur (Bang Rak)

After registration we obtain Kor Ror 2 (marriage register) and Kor Ror 3 (marriage certificate), translated and MFA-legalized for use in the foreign spouse's home country.

Frequently asked questions

Can clients abroad use this service without travelling to Thailand?
Yes. Notarise documents in your home country with local Apostille, courier the originals to us, and we run the full Thai-side workflow and return everything by DHL or FedEx within the agreed window.
What if the file needs minor edits after delivery?
Minor edits (typos, layout) are free within 7 days. Substantive content changes are quoted as a new scope.
Why is an Affidavit of Translation Accuracy required?
US, Australian, Canadian, and UK courts require the translator's sworn statement before a notary attesting that the translation is complete and accurate. Without it the filing is rejected on intake.
How long does MFA + Embassy take end-to-end?
Standard 7-10 business days (MFA 3-5 + Embassy 3-5). Same-Day MFA + Premium Embassy Slot reduces it to 2-3 days with a 50-100% surcharge.
How do I engage you from abroad?
Use Remote POA: sign a power-of-attorney before a notary in your country, get it Apostilled, and courier it to us. We then handle every Thai-side step.
Is Same-Day rush available for Bangkok Marriage Registration at Amphur (Bang Rak)?
Yes — for documents that don't require MFA. Book before 11:00 the same day; +100% surcharge applies.
What payment methods do you accept?
All channels: bank transfer, PromptPay, Visa/Master/JCB, Stripe, Wise, and USD wire for international clients. Full Thai/English tax invoices.
Who certifies Bangkok Marriage Registration at Amphur (Bang Rak)?
Notarial work is certified by Lawyers Council–licensed attorneys; translation work is certified by Ministry of Justice–listed translators.
Where can Bangkok Marriage Registration at Amphur (Bang Rak) be used?
Worldwide — depending on certification: Apostille for Hague countries, MFA + embassy authentication for non-Hague countries.
What accuracy guarantee do you offer for Bangkok Marriage Registration at Amphur (Bang Rak)?
A written guarantee — if the destination authority rejects due to our error, we redo for free and refund the government fee in full.
